San José State University Writing Center www.sjsu.edu/writingcenter Written by Sarah Andersen Sentence Types and Functions Choosing what types of sentences to use in an essay can be challenging for several reasons. The writer must consider the following questions: Are my ideas simple or complex? Do my ideas require shorter statements or longer explanations? How do I express my ideas clearly? This handout discusses the basic components of a sentence, the different types of sentences, and various functions of each type of sentence. What Is a Sentence? A sentence is a complete set of words that conveys meaning. A sentence can communicate o a statement (I am studying.) o a command (Go away.) o an exclamation (I’m so excited!) o a question (What time is it?) A sentence is composed of one or more clauses. A clause contains a subject and verb. Independent and Dependent Clauses There are two types of clauses: independent clauses and dependent clauses. A sentence contains at least one independent clause and may contain one or more dependent clauses. An independent clause (or main clause) o is a complete thought. o can stand by itself. A dependent clause (or subordinate clause) o is an incomplete thought. o cannot stand by itself. You can spot a dependent clause by identifying the subordinating conjunction. A subordinating conjunction creates a dependent clause that relies on the rest of the sentence for meaning. Gottlob Frege Patricia A. Blanchette This is the penultimate version of the essay whose final version appears in the Oxford Handbook of Nineteenth-Century German Philosophy, M. Forster and K. Gjesdal (eds), Oxford University Press 2015, pp 207-227 Abstract Gottlob Frege (1848-1925) made significant contributions to both pure mathematics and philosophy. His most important technical contribution, of both mathematical and philosophical significance, is the introduction of a formal system of quantified logic. His work of a more purely- philosophical kind includes the articulation and persuasive defense of anti-psychologism in mathematics and logic, the rigorous pursuit of the thesis that arithmetic is reducible to logic, and the introduction of the distinction between sense and reference in the philosophy of language. Frege’s work has gone on to influence contemporary work across a broad spectrum, including the philosophy of mathematics and logic, the philosophy of language, and the philosophy of mind. This essay describes the historical development of Frege’s central views, and the connections between those views. Introduction Friedrich Ludwig Gottlob Frege was born on November 8, 1848 in the Hanseatic town of Wismar. He was educated in mathematics at the University of Jena and at the University of Göttingen, from which latter he received his doctorate in 1873. He defended his Habilitation the next year in Jena, and took up a position immediately at the University of Jena. Here he spent his entire academic career, lecturing in mathematics and logic, retiring in 1918. Against logical form Zolta´n Gendler Szabo´ Conceptions of logical form are stranded between extremes. On one side are those who think the logical form of a sentence has little to do with logic; on the other, those who think it has little to do with the sentence. Most of us would prefer a conception that strikes a balance: logical form that is an objective feature of a sentence and captures its logical character. I will argue that we cannot get what we want. What are these extreme conceptions? In linguistics, logical form is typically con- ceived of as a level of representation where ambiguities have been resolved. According to one highly developed view—Chomsky’s minimalism—logical form is one of the outputs of the derivation of a sentence. The derivation begins with a set of lexical items and after initial mergers it splits into two: on one branch phonological operations are applied without semantic effect; on the other are semantic operations without phono- logical realization. At the end of the first branch is phonological form, the input to the articulatory–perceptual system; and at the end of the second is logical form, the input to the conceptual–intentional system.1 Thus conceived, logical form encompasses all and only information required for interpretation. But semantic and logical information do not fully overlap. The connectives “and” and “but” are surely not synonyms, but the difference in meaning probably does not concern logic. On the other hand, it is of utmost logical importance whether “finitely many” or “equinumerous” are logical constants even though it is hard to see how this information could be essential for their interpretation. -

Truth-Bearers and Truth Value* I. Introduction The purpose of this document is to explain the following concepts and the relationships between them: statements, propositions, and truth value. In what follows each of these will be discussed in turn. II. Language and Truth-Bearers A. Statements 1. Introduction For present purposes, we will define the term “statement” as follows. Statement: A meaningful declarative sentence.1 It is useful to make sure that the definition of “statement” is clearly understood. 2. Sentences in General To begin with, a statement is a kind of sentence. Obviously, not every string of words is a sentence. Consider: “John store.” Here we have two nouns with a period after them—there is no verb. Grammatically, this is not a sentence—it is just a collection of words with a dot after them. Consider: “If I went to the store.” This isn’t a sentence either. “I went to the store.” is a sentence. However, using the word “if” transforms this string of words into a mere clause that requires another clause to complete it. For example, the following is a sentence: “If I went to the store, I would buy milk.” This issue is not merely one of conforming to arbitrary rules. Philosophy 565: Philosophy of Language Prof. Clare Batty Russell, “On Denoting” 1. More Philosophical Jargon definite description: a singular noun phrase which applies to exactly one person, often beginning with the definite article: e.g., ‘the funniest woman in Canada’, the present King of France’. According to Russell, a phrase is denoting solely “in virtue of its form”. This is to say, the phrase needn’t actually denote in order to be a denoting phrase. Law of the Excluded Middle: By the law of the excluded middle, either ‘A is B’ or ‘A is not B’ must be true. 2. Frege and Russell We now know that Frege is committed to: (F3) Ordinary proper names and definite descriptions are singular terms. (F4) Ordinary proper names and definite descriptions all have sense (and perhaps reference). (ST1) The business of a singular term is to refer to an object. (ST2) A sentence containing a singular term has no truth-value if there is no object corresponding to that singular term. Russell’s focus is on definite descriptions. Not under discussion at this point: proper names (e.g. ‘Clare’, ‘Kentucky’, etc.) Russell denies (F3) and, as a result (he claims), (F4). Like Frege, Russell thinks that his alternative view can deal with certain problems. “The evidence for [my] theory is derived from difficulties which seem unavoidable if we regard denoting phrases as standing for genuine constituents of the propositions in whose verbal expressions they occur."
